Earache To Release BRING ME THE HORIZON Debut In USA




Earache To Release BRING ME THE HORIZON Debut In USA


Earache Records Inc, is pleased to announce the conclusion of a North American licensing deal of a British band that is not afraid to go beyond the expectations of a modern extreme metal act. Then again, this is no ordinary modern metal act. This is Bring Me The Horizon.
 
In the seemingly short span of 3 years since their formation, Bring Me The
Horizon has accomplished more in that time than most bands do in 10. In
2006, Bring Me The Horizon was the recipient of a KERRANG! Award for “Best
British Newcomer” and held steady on MySpace’s top 100 list of most played
bands, currently boasting a playcount of 4.2 Million plays. Bring Me The Horizon were only 1 of 2 UK acts to chart in the MySpace top 100 (the other
being Coldplay). In addition, they’ve toured with bands such as Bleeding
Through and Killswitch Engage and performed a show-stealing set at the UK's
Download Festival.

Garnering much attention and acclaim for their UK and online exploits,
Bring Me The Horizon is now ready to make waves stateside with their
debut album, ‘Count Your Blessings’  being released on August 14th on Earache. Known for their technically beautiful, yet honestly brutal sound, the band’s widespread appeal has been swelling to a point of no return.

Bring Me The Horizon is being licensed to Earache through their UK home label Visible Noise and they could not be more thrilled about the deal. Julie Weir, the A&R director of Visible Noise says, “Bring Me The Horizon are an extreme and incendiary band, and where better for them to be released
in the US than through the home of extreme music!!”
Earache Records US Label Head, Al Dawson believes that the band’s future now burns
even brighter; “We are overjoyed to be given the opportunity to work with Bring Me The Horizon – They are one of the most talented extreme bands to come out of England in the last few years.”

It is only a matter of time until Bring Me The Horizon ushers in the New Era of British Extreme Music.

Akercocke to play Belfast tonight despite protests

Akercocke to play Belfast tonight despite protests


Akercocke will play Belfast tonight despite protests from Christian groups
and a strong police presence at the Belfast show.
The impending release of UK death metal country gents Akercocke's
latest album "Antichrist" caused so much uproar amongst Northern Ireland¹s
religious community that the band appeared on BBC Northern Ireland on
Wednesday night.
`Nolan Live' is BBC Northern Ireland's flagship topical affairs series.
It is presented by double Royal Television Society Award winner Stephen
Nolan, who also hosts a daily radio show on BBC Radio Ulster and a
weekend slot on BBC Five Live.

Akercocke 'Antichrist' album banned by US pressing plant


Akercocke 'Antichrist' album banned by US pressing plant




The forthcoming album from Akercocke, abruptly titled ‘Antichrist’, has run into more controversy. The provocative nature of the record has already led to problems in Ireland, where the band will take part in a live discussion on the ‘Nolan Live’ show on BBC1 Northern Ireland next Wednesday at 10.45pm with members of the Irish Catholic clergy.

Now the album has run into problems in the US, where the pressing plant handling the production of the album, Disc USA, has refused to handle the record due its ‘anti-Christian’ perspective.

Commenting on the decision, Akercocke frontman Jason Mendonca stated:

“I rather perturbed that in this day and age, the 21st Century, people are so uptight.
Whatever happened to freedom of speech and freedom of expression in the alleged democracy of the USA?
Censorship is always ugly no matter how you view it. It smacks of fascism to me.”

“What other works of art are barred to the good people of America?
The attitude of the printers is typical of the brainwashed. Judging something (literally) by its cover.
Anyone who took the time to look into our history would recognise that we have always stated we are anything but anti-christian.
It's divisive attitudes such as this that bring about conflict. Conflict through ignorance.”

Akercocke’s ‘Antichrist’ is currently set for May 28 release in UK/Europe, with an American release due on July 17.

Fast-rising Yorkshire thrashers EVILE began the process of recording their debut album with producer Flemming Rasmussen (METALLICA, MORBID ANGEL) at Sweet Silence Studios in Copenhagen, Denmark. Check out pictures from the studio at the Evile <a HREF=" http://blog.myspace.com/evileuk">myspace page</a>. Songtitles set to appear on the CD include "Man against Machine" and "Burned Alive".

The album will be completed sometime in June for an August 27 release on Earache Records.

EVILE formed three years ago in Huddersfield, Yorkshire, U.K. by brothers Matt Drake (vocals/guitar) and Ol Drake (lead guitar), along with Ben Carter (drums) and Mike Alexander (bass) and has since rapidly picked up a rabid following, eager to enjoy a night of heads-down, no-nonsense thrash.

While unsigned, EVILE were hand-picked to play two prestigious U.K. festivals in the summer of 2006 — Bloodstock Open Air and most recently, Damnation Festival — both to great acclaim from fans.
